antiX
Os & Utilities
antiX is a fast, lightweight and easy-to-use Linux distribution based on Debian stable. It uses the IceWM window manager and is optimized to run well on older hardware.

Arch Anywhere
Os & Utilities
Arch Anywhere is a Linux distribution based on Arch Linux that features an easy-to-use graphical installer. It aims to provide a hassle-free Arch Linux installation experience for less technical users.
